To come full circle on the story, I think mini magic was the first to come up with #049 as the possible chassis number for Barazi's F1 through one of his sources. We ran with that assumption for quite some time before someone - Le Man's brother, I believe - finally put eyes on the chassis plate and returned with a photograph identifying it as #046 instead. I think Patrick had similar info/photos the following day as both saw the car at the same location.

We haven't always been perfect, but we try to base our assumptions on available info and work hard to get it right in the end. Each little piece of the puzzle we can confirm helps to solve other mysteries. I'm also careful to be clear when something is assumed versus when it is known fact, and others are too most of the time.
